A Spacious, Imposing 4 Double Bedroom Detached Home, in a private position at the end of Holywell Gutter Lane, in Tupsley, Hereford. Offering over 2,500 sq.ft of family living with a large driveway, double garage, and gardens backing onto playing fields.

Entrance Hall – Sitting Room – Study – Kitchen/Dining/Family Room – Utility Room – Downstairs WC – Landing – Main Bedroom with Walk-in Wardrobe & Ensuite – Bedroom 2 with Ensuite – 2 Further Double Bedrooms – Family Bathroom – Double Garage – Driveway Parking – Landscaped Rear Garden with Playing Field Access

Tucked away at the end of Holywell Gutter Lane in a peaceful cul-de-sac, this modern executive home offers over 2,500 sq. Ft of beautifully presented living space. At its heart is an impressive open plan kitchen, dining and family room, complemented by two further reception rooms that provide versatility for everyday living or entertaining.

The first floor includes four generous bedrooms, with an ensuite and walk-in wardrobe to the main. Outside, a large driveway and integral double garage sit to the front, while the rear garden enjoys direct access to neighbouring playing fields.

Well-kept gardens, bright interiors and a welcoming layout make this an ideal family home. Bishops School and local amenities are within walking distance, with Hereford city centre offering wider shopping, leisure and transport links close by.

The Property

Entrance Hall: A welcoming central hallway with travertine flooring and a striking oak and glass staircase, forming the central feature. Useful fitted cloakroom storage sits to one side, with doors leading into the reception rooms, kitchen and downstairs WC.

Kitchen/Dining/Family Room: The heart of the home, stretching across the rear with French doors opening directly to the garden. A stylish fitted kitchen offers sleek gloss cabinetry with granite worktops, a central island with breakfast seating, inset sink and integrated appliances - including double fan oven, hob with extractor fan hood, dishwasher, and under-counter fridge. The space flows naturally into a generous dining and family living area, with travertine flooring throughout and garden views creating a light and sociable hub.

Sitting Room: A well-proportioned reception with contemporary décor, featuring a central fireplace with woodburner set beneath a solid oak beam mantel. French doors lead out to the garden, providing excellent natural light and extending the living space outdoors.

Study: Ideal as a home office, reading room or snug, offering flexibility to suit family needs.

Utility Room: Fitted with additional units, laminate worktop, sink and under-counter space for a washing machine and tumble dryer. A practical link between the kitchen and garage, with side external access.

First Floor Landing: A spacious landing with matching oak and glass balustrade, window to the front and access to all bedrooms. Includes a built-in airing cupboard behind veneer oak door and hatch access to the loft.

Main Bedroom Suite: A generous double bedroom, boasting a walk-in wardrobe and ample space for additional furniture. Decorated in calm tones, with a large window providing rear outlook across playing fields. The ensuite is a fully tiled contemporary shower room, including walk-in glazed enclosure with thermo shower, wash basin, WC, LED mirror and towel radiator.

Bedroom 2 with Ensuite: Another large double bedroom, decorated in vibrant style with large built-in wardrobe. The ensuite is smartly finished with enclosed corner shower, wash basin, WC, LED mirror and chrome towel radiator.

Bedrooms 3 & 4: Both further bedrooms are capacious doubles, with fitted carpets and built-in wardrobes.

Family Bathroom: A fully equipped modern white suite, including a full-size bath with centre taps, oversized walk-in thermo shower with glazed panel, WC, pedestal basin and chrome towel radiator.

Outside

The property is approached via a private tarmac driveway at the end of the lane, with space to turn, parking for multiple vehicles and integral double garage with twin roller doors. To the rear, the garden is mainly laid to lawn, with a full width decked terrace providing space for outdoor seating and entertaining. A timber shed is positioned in the corner, and a rear gate opens directly onto the neighbouring playing fields, enhancing the sense of space and outlook. There is access to the front either side of the house, with a fenced in gravel area providing further parking if needed.

Practicalities

Herefordshire Council Tax Band ‘G’
Gas Central Heating
Double Glazed Throughout
All Mains Services
Full Fibre Broadband Available
